What is the cheapest month to fly from Wilmington to Thailand?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Wilmington to Thailand,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Wilmington to Thailand is January, when tickets cost $1,195 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and December,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$2,784 and $2,353 respectively.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Thailand?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to Thailand is generally in the afternoon, when round-trip flights cost $1,451 on average. Morning departures are around 24% cheaper than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Thailand is generally in the evening,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$1,999.
